Because a curved sofa isn't able to fit in a straight line against the wall, it's essential to plan your space meticulously. Before you even buy one, be sure to know the overall dimensions of the sofa and physically mark them out on the floor using masking tape. You can then be sure that your major purchase will be the right size for your living space.

A curved sofa can also be found to be a little larger than a traditional modular piece, which is why it's important to take this into account when shopping. Some brands offer detailed product descriptions that provide this information, whereas others will only provide an overall size without mentioning specific dimensions.

If you like to change the furniture in your home at times A curved sofa might not be the ideal option for you. Since a curved couch doesn't sit tightly against the walls, it may cause gaps in your seating arrangement, which can be difficult to fill with other pieces.
